Transaction 8d520dbec90c55627fc68a15482e87d31824ec7f61693687d6370dca7b0812fb
1 Input
1 Output
-
8d520dbec90c55627fc68a15482e87d31824ec7f61693687d6370dca7b0812fb:0
- value
- 99053
- script pubkey
- OP_0 OP_PUSHBYTES_20 6bb95ea90cb89d02fa386e58dbe0ca9317db9aa9
- address
- bc1qdwu4a2gvhzws973cdevdhcx2jvtahx4f88f7vk